A Massachusetts bride and her co-workers helped save a man's life after he suffered a heart attack. Everyone at Micaela Johnson's wedding was dancing when a wedding guest suddenly collapsed. By a stroke of luck, the bride is an emergency room nurse and many of the guests were also nurses. They sprang into action, tending to the stricken man on the dance floor. The nurses did CPR and applied a defibrillator to his chest. The team was able to keep the guest alive until an ambulance arrived.
